Default this wiring diagram doesn't make sense

I downloaded this diagram from here, but it doesn't seem to make sense. something is wrong, or missing or more likely, I am missing something. How does the key switch get power?

does anyone have a diagram of the F & R switch wiring?

Default Re: this wiring diagram doesn't make sense

Are you sure this is the correct schematic/wiring diagram for your cart? There are two or three floating around that are almost the same, except one microswitch on F/R assembly instead of two like on the drawing you posted and the B+ source for solenoid coil is different.

It is a little hard to see, but the keyswitch is actually on the B- side of the solenoid coil.
Here is your drawing with solenoid activation circuit traced.
Heavy lines are 6Ga cables, thinner lines are 18Ga wires.
Red is B+
Blue is B-
